These concepts include the basic cardiac anatomy and physiology, proper lead placement for a 5- and 12- lead, technical aspects of the EKG machine and how to calculate heart rate, how to interpret a rhythm strip, and several advanced concepts working with the 12-lead EKG machines. You'll also learn how to prep a patient for EKG monitoring and troubleshooting EKG artifacts. This training will allow you to assist the physician with diagnosing myocardial infarction, cardiac arrhythmias, and heart rhythm irregularities. EKG machines are used in physicians' offices, h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are facilities.
